    Recognizing Language and Emotional Tone from Music Lyrics Using IBM Watson Tone Analyzer
    (Proceedings of 2019 3rd IEEE International Conference on Electrical, Computer and Communication Technologies, ICECCT 2023, IEEE, 2019-10-17) Marouf, Ahmed Al; Hossain, Rafayet; Sarker, Md. Rahmatul Kabir Rasel; Pandey, Bishwajeet; Siddiquee, Shah Md. Tanvir
    Music has a soothing impact on listener's mood and emotional states. Apart from the rhythm, sequence, instrumental effects on a song, lyrics could be considered as the most vital element. Lyricists' mood and affection towards a song while writing could be understand from the lyrics. Lyrics does have the elements of fictions such as language tone, language style, diction and voice are well maintained in music lyrics. Understanding the tone of a song both language and emotional tones are essential to develop different interactive applications. Music players, video repositories, video sharing sites could use the understandings to recommend next song to play according to the music interest or mood of the listeners. In this paper, we have investigated the possibilities to use IBM Watson Tone Analyzer, an API service to analyze language and emotional tones from song lyrics. We have extracted the features from a 300 English song dataset using the supported API service and formulated a machine learning methodology to classify the language tone (analytical, confident and tentative) and emotional tone (anger, fear, joy and sadness). For classification, we have applied different classifiers including Naïve Bayes, decision tree, random forest, sequential minimal optimization and simple logistic regression.

    Recommendation Approach of English Songs Title Based on Latent Dirichlet Allocation Applied on Lyrics
    (Proceedings of 2019 3rd IEEE International Conference on Electrical, Computer and Communication Technologies, ICECCT 2019, IEEE, 2019-10-17) Hossain, Rafayet; Sarker, Md. Rahmatul Kabir Rasel; Mimo, Mehejabin; Marouf, Ahmed Al; Pandey, Bishwajeet
    The significance of music has evolved due to the vast diversity of entertainment industry. Songs are the widely used entertainment segment that can influence directly to the heart of the listeners. Choosing a suitable title for a song is considered as a common problem faced by the music directors. As the title gives the first impression of the song and only by the title listeners usually decide whether they will listen to this song or not, thus makes it a challenging task to determine. Lyrics are the most influential part of a particular song apart from the tune, rhythm, fusion, singer, genre etc. In this paper, we propose an approach to estimate and recommend the title of the song based on its lyrics. We have applied Latent Dirichlet Allocation (LDA) to find the hidden or implied topic of the song. The output of the LDA algorithm provides scoring on the significant words, which are passed to an estimation process to generate a song title. The proposed approach was experimented on over 200 English songs database having vast diversity in genre. The approach could be evaluated by the existing song title and the evaluation process is same as any recommendation system.
